Spine, a stylish mix of cyberpunk game and action movie, was first announced in November 2023. GlobalESportNews editor Kevin spoke to the developers at the time and drew a euphoric conclusion!

Now, for the first time, real gameplay can be seen by the public: On a rooftop against a dystopian sci-fi backdrop, the heroine clears numerous enemies out of the way with spectacular gun-fu moves.

She combines punches, grabs, throws and finishing moves with guns. The whole thing is like a playable version of John Wick with a futuristic twist.

When Spine will be released is still unclear. The single-player action game promises a gripping revenge story, a fluid melee combat system and cutting-edge graphics thanks to Unreal Engine 5.

The developers themselves describe the game with a question: What would it be like to be at the epicenter of an action movie, kicking enemies out of your hand and fending off bullets with your trusty katana?
